In both Latin American countries and Spain, yaya is another Spanish word that can be used to refer to your grandmother. Meaning and examples for 'grandfather' in Spanish-English dictionary. Yayo is another affectionate way to say grandpa in Spanish. Tata – Grandpa. In Spain, as in most Spanish-speaking countries, grandparents are most often referred to with the formal titles of “abuela” (grandma) and “abuelo” (grandpa).
